MANILA, Philippines — The Philippine National Police on Friday said that there were six new cases of the coronavirus disease among its members for a total of 456.
The PNP also said that 276 personnel have successfully recovered from the respiratory disease with five new recoveries recorded.Meanwhile, probable cases among PNP personnel are at 673 while 884 are suspect cases.
